Combating Money Laundering and Terrorism Financing in the Kyrgyz Republic
The Law of the Kyrgyz Republic on Combating Money Laundering and Terrorism Financing establishes an authorized state body responsible for combating these crimes. This article highlights the powers, responsibilities, and functions of this critical institution.
Authorized State Body
The law designates an authorized state body to combat money laundering and terrorism financing in the Kyrgyz Republic. Other government authorities are not permitted to interfere in matters related to this control except as specified by the law or other laws of the country.
Functions and Powers of the Authorized State Body
1. Collection, Processing, and Analysis of Information
- The authorized state body collects, processes, and analyzes information related to operations (transactions) subject to mandatory control.
- This includes gathering data from various sources to identify potential money laundering and terrorism financing activities.
2. Development and Implementation of Measures
- The authorized state body develops and implements measures to improve the prevention, detection, and suppression of suspicious operations (transactions) and connections with anti-money laundering and terrorism financing.
- These measures may include training for financial institutions, monitoring of transactions, and cooperation with international partners.
3. Submission of Information to Courts and Investigation Agencies
- The authorized state body submits generalized materials related to the financing of terrorism and legalization (laundering) of proceeds from crime to courts and investigation agencies upon formal written requests.
- This information helps law enforcement agencies investigate and prosecute individuals involved in these crimes.
4. Carrying Out Activities on Anti-Money Laundering and Terrorism Financing
- The authorized state body carries out its activities in these areas, including access to databases maintained by state bodies.
- This enables the agency to gather intelligence and track suspicious transactions in real-time.
5. Access to Databases
- The authorized state body has the right to access (use) to databases formed and (or) maintained by state bodies.
- This includes sharing information with other government agencies to enhance cooperation and coordination.
6. Sending Information to Law Enforcement Agencies
- In the presence of sufficient evidence that an operation (transaction) is associated with terrorism financing and legalization (laundering) of proceeds from crime, it sends the appropriate synthesis to law enforcement agencies in accordance with their competence.
- This ensures that relevant information reaches the right authorities for further action.
7. Publication of Normative Legal Acts
- The authorized state body publishes normative legal acts on matters within its competence under this Law and other necessary for execution by persons in the information.
- This helps ensure that all stakeholders are aware of their responsibilities and obligations.
8. Sending Written Requests to Providers of Information
- The authorized state body sends written requests to providers of information according to the information specified in Article 4 of this Law, in respect of operations (transactions) subject to mandatory control, and in respect of information related to clients and beneficial owners (beneficiaries).
- This enables the agency to collect necessary data from financial institutions and other relevant parties.
9. Requesting Further Information from State Bodies and Reporting Persons
- It has the right to request and receive further information related to anti-money laundering and terrorism financing from state bodies and reporting persons.
- This helps the authorized state body gather a comprehensive understanding of potential threats and take effective measures to combat them.
